To Wei Chen, the movent of the Sacred Fla Valley disciple leader appeared in his eyes like slow motion, similar to those channels that showcase various objects in slow motion. Even though this guy was much faster than the first one he had bitch-slapped, Wei Chen could still clearly see his flaws and patterns.

Since the disciple leader rushed at him with full killing intent, using a combat technique ant to burn him to a crisp, Wei Chen quickly grasped the inner workings of the technique. In fact, he felt he could even imitate it, adapting it with his own understanding and knowledge.

This must be the work of the Samsara Sovereign’s Scripture, which he had chosen as his main cultivation thod.

To put it bluntly, if he were to be retransmigrated into his previous world and study again, he was certain he could graduate from MIT with Summa Cum Laude award, instead of being a dropout from a second-rate college like he once was.

Wei Chen avoided the attack by a hair’s breadth before slapping the attacking hand, causing the Sacred Fla disciple to lose his stance and reveal a wide opening.

Slap!!

A resounding slap echoed through the air. This ti, it was Wei Chen’s right backhand striking the Sacred Fla lead disciple.

Of course, there was a slight delay compared to his previous move. This lead disciple was at the early Nascent Soul Realm, which made him stronger than the last one, who was only at the Core Formation stage. It took Wei Chen a little more effort to break through his stance.

The lead disciple was slapped hard. His heart filled with disbelief, his vision spun, and his body twirled through the air in a perfect arc before crashing to the ground, still dazed and confused.

What happened?

Who am I?

Why am I here?

These were the questions floating through the Sacred Fla lead disciple’s mind. He never imagined he would be this weak when facing soone whose cultivation he couldn’t even sense.

Wait! Could it be that this guy has a much higher cultivation than and just hides it?

If that was the case, then it made sense that he lost. He turned toward his elder, wanting to ask him to intervene since he had clearly kicked an iron plate without realizing it.

"Vagabond, it’s not a gentlemanly thing to bully the weak. You know that my disciples have lower cultivation than you," the Sacred Fla Elder said.

"Last I checked, they attacked first. If I didn’t slap them back, they would think I’m a pushover," Wei Chen replied.

He didn’t bother correcting the misunderstanding, even though his cultivation was actually lower than that of the Sacred Fla disciples. As far as he knew, appearing to have higher cultivation served as a good deterrent, a layer of protection against unnecessary trouble.

Besides, he was doing a live broadcast right now. If he corrected the misunderstanding, it would only bring him more problems. He would have to deal with all kinds of brainless idiots trying to prove themselves by challenging or killing him.

So, he simply let them assu he was stronger. As for pretending to be so genius who could defeat cultivators above his level? He wasn’t so protagonist who needed to prove himself to his sect or his parents who saw him as trash. Why would he bother doing that?

"Even so, you shouldn’t be so heavy-handed!" the Sacred Fla Elder tried to reason.

Wei Chen smirked. "I see. You an... if so idiots with lower cultivation than you attacked you with the intent to kill, you’d just stand there, let them hit you, and then pat them on the back afterward? Is that what you’re saying?"

Outside the broadcast, Mo Xingyao chuckled. This guy was truly wicked. Who would ever do that? Even the kindest people she knew would at least beat their attackers into the ground, not just slap them like Wei Chen did. She wondered what Wei Chen would do if that elder chose to be shaless and said yes.

As if foretold, the Sacred Fla Elder snorted, glaring at Wei Chen with disdain.

"Of course. Since you have higher cultivation and probably lived much longer, seniors like us must be more tolerant than juniors. The saying ’respect the old and love the young’ is not sothing we hear and ignore; it’s sothing we should live by," the Sacred Fla Elder declared self-righteously. He didn’t believe it himself, but he just saying this to gain face, and moral high ground, a little bit of shalessness never hurt.

Hearing this, Wei Chen’s smile widened. This guy shalessness is off the chart, if he had a shaless o-ter this guy would have surely explode it!

He clapped his hands as if he had just heard sothing deeply moving.

"Very comndable. So..." He turned toward the group of Heavenly Sword Sect disciples. "Who wants to kill him?" He asked, pointing at the Sacred Fla Elder with his thumb.

The Heavenly Sword Sect disciples were startled, looking at each other in confusion.

Of course, they wanted to kill that old bastard! But none of them believed his words. What if that shaless elder decided to go back on his statent and strike them down instead?

Jian Heng frowned at Wei Chen’s question. He knew this shaless elder didn’t an what he said, but then he rembered—this was being broadcast. Could it be that this guy wanted to ruin the elder’s reputation live on air?

But to trade a disciple’s life for that... even if it gained the sect so face, Jian Heng didn’t want to risk his disciples’ lives over it.

{What do you think you’re doing?} Jian Heng asked, sending a telepathic ssage to Wei Chen.

Wei Chen looked back at Jian Heng, who was staring at him as if demanding an answer.

{Do you trust ?} Wei Chen asked through the sa telepathic link.

{No. We just t. I don’t know you well enough to gamble with our disciples’ lives.}

{You’re not fast enough to help them, are you?} Wei Chen asked.

Jian Heng was silent. He didn’t respond, but his expression showed hesitation. He wasn’t sure if he could stop whatever this shaless elder might do in ti.

Wei Chen pressed further. {If you’re not sure, I’ll help them myself. But if I resolve this, can I consider it that you owe a favor?}

{I’m not in a position to make the entire sect owe you anything,} Jian Heng replied.

{No, I an just you. Even if it involves the sect, I promise it won’t be anything dangerous,} Wei Chen negotiated.

{Fine! But if any of our disciples lose their lives, you’ll bear the consequences!} Jian Heng warned.

{Believe , it won’t co to that. Just watch,} Wei Chen smirked.

After getting that assurance, Jian Heng turned toward the group of disciples.

"Who wants to put the Sacred Fla Elder’s words to the test?" Jian Heng asked.

The disciples looked at each other nervously, whispering among themselves, but none dared to move.

Seeing this, the Sacred Fla Elder smirked. This was expected. Who would risk their life over such a bet?

Even if they did attack him, they were all at the Foundation Establishnt stage. None of them were Core Disciples at Core Formation or Nascent Soul who could actually threaten him.

He had done his howork. These beaten-up disciples were just outer disciples, not the elites of the Heavenly Sword Sect.

But then, a chubby-looking outer disciple stepped out of the group, determination burning in his eyes. It was clear he wanted to prove himself.

"I... I’ll do it!" the chubby disciple declared.

"What’s your na, disciple?" Jian Heng asked.

"Answering Vice Sect Leader, this disciple’s na is Pang Hu!" Pang Hu said, cupping his fists respectfully.

Jian Heng nodded and signaled for him to begin.

The Sacred Fla Elder smirked and swaggered forward. "Go ahead! If I raise my hand to defend, I’ll change my surna to Dog!" he said confidently. There was no way this fat little trash could harm him.

Hearing this, Wei Chen turned toward the cara. "He said it, folks. You all heard him," Wei Chen said with a smirk toward the invisible audience.

"Who are you talking to, vagabond?" the Sacred Fla Elder frowned.

"Oh, nothing important. You don’t need to worry about it," Wei Chen replied with a sunny smile.

Outside the broadcast, on Mo Xingyao’s side, she sat upright, watching with anticipation. She wasn’t the only one excited, Xin Hao also found the scene on the strange screen highly entertaining.

Handso Tall and Rich: [Hahahaha! That’s right! If this fatty can hurt the Sacred Fla Elder, I’ll give you one million spirit stones! But if he can’t, you have to serve as my bodyguard, vagabond!]

Little Wealthy Demon: [Huh? Xin Hao, why do you suddenly want him as your bodyguard? Doesn’t your family already assign you one?]

Handso Tall and Rich: [Of course I have bodyguards, but a Soul Transformation bodyguard isn’t easy to find! This vagabond slapped a Nascent Soul cultivator like it was nothing. He must be at least at the Soul Transformation Realm!]

Little Wealthy Demon: [Just one million for a Soul Transformation bodyguard? Is your family that poor, Xin Hao? Do you think soone at that level works for pocket change? That’s even cheaper than that artifact you bought at auction!]

Handso Tall and Rich: [Fine! Five million! I’ll raise the bet to five million spirit stones!]

Little Wealthy Demon: [Wei Chen! I’ll give you eight million spirit stones! Be my bodyguard instead!]

Handso Tall and Rich: [You dare compete with this young master!? Fine! Fifteen million! That’s the sa as my father’s bodyguard’s pay!]

Little Wealthy Demon: [Tch!]

Handso Tall and Rich: [HAHAHAHAHA!]

Xin Hao laughed in the chat room, but then Wei Chen received a private ssage from Mo Xingyao.

Little Wealthy Demon: [Hey, I already helped you bait him. If you win the bet, give half of that amount, okay?]

Wei Chen smiled wryly. Why the hell did I beco this girl’s bargaining chip?
